Skip to main content

The Build vs Buy Decision

Every growing business faces this question: should we hire an in-house marketing team or partner with an agency? The answer depends on your budget, goals, and growth stage. Let’s break down the real costs and benefits of each approach.

The True Cost of an In-House Team

Building a competent in-house digital marketing team requires multiple specialists. A marketing manager, SEO specialist, content writer, PPC manager, social media manager, and designer add up quickly. With salaries, benefits, tools, and overhead, you’re looking at $300,000 to $500,000 or more annually for a mid-level team.

That doesn’t include training, software subscriptions, or the cost of hiring mistakes. The average cost of a bad hire is 30% of that employee’s annual salary.

The Agency Alternative

A full-service agency provides an entire team of specialists for a fraction of the cost. Most agencies charge between $3,000 and $15,000 per month, giving you access to SEO experts, content creators, PPC managers, designers, strategists, and analytics professionals.

That’s $36,000 to $180,000 annually vs $300,000+ for in-house. The savings are substantial, especially for small and mid-sized businesses.

Advantages of an Agency

  • Diverse expertise — Access to specialists across all channels
  • Scalability — Scale up or down without hiring/firing
  • Tools and technology — Agencies invest in premium tools you’d have to buy separately
  • Fresh perspective — Outside viewpoint from working with multiple industries
  • Accountability — Performance-driven relationships with clear metrics
  • Speed — Hit the ground running without months of hiring and training

When In-House Makes Sense

Large companies with $1M+ marketing budgets often benefit from in-house teams for day-to-day execution, supplemented by agency partnerships for strategy and specialized work. Companies in highly regulated industries may need in-house expertise for compliance. And businesses with very unique products may need dedicated personnel who develop deep product knowledge.

The Hybrid Approach

Many successful companies use a hybrid model: a small in-house team for day-to-day needs and brand stewardship, partnered with an agency for strategic planning, specialized execution, and scaling campaigns.

Making the Right Choice for Your Business

Consider your budget, growth goals, industry complexity, and how quickly you need results. For most businesses under $10M in revenue, an agency partnership delivers better ROI than building in-house.

Discover the Brandastic Difference

Brandastic gives you a full marketing team without the full-time price tag. Let’s discuss how we can grow your business.